Вступ до Fling: бот-герой VIQC 2021-2022

Щороку IQ Hero Bot створюється з IQ Super Kit , щоб надати командам стартову точку для гри в поточну гру VEX IQ Challenge. Він призначений для досвідчених команд, які зможуть швидко зібрати робота для дослідження динаміки гри. Нові команди також можуть використовувати Hero Bot, щоб навчитися цінним будівельним навичкам і мати робота, якого вони можуть налаштувати, щоб змагатися з ним на початку сезону.

Гра VEX IQ Challenge 2021-2022 розпочинається. Перегляньте цю сторінку , щоб дізнатися більше про гру та як у неї грають. Бот-герой цього сезону, який гратиме у Pitching In is Fling. Ви можете переглянути інструкції зі збірки Fling для отримання додаткової інформації.

Для визначення ігор, які використовуються в цій статті, огляду правил гри та підрахунку очок, перегляньте Посібник з гри для Pitching In.


Окулярні можливості

Fling може зараховувати такі способи:

fling-intro-01-new.png

Забиття м'яча у високі ворота

Використовуючи кидок Fling's Intake і Catapult Arm, м'ячі можна ефективно забивати у High Goal.

fling-intro-02-new.png

Забиття м'яча в нижні ворота

М'ячі можна легко штовхати в Low Goal за допомогою Fling's Intake.

fling-intro-03-new.png

Очистіть кулі від загону

Fling може використовувати Intake, щоб ефективно очистити кулі від загону.

fling-intro-04-new.png

Низький завис від підвісної штанги

Fling може використовувати руку катапульти, щоб дотягнутися до висячої штанги та повиснути.


Особливості конструкції

Деякі з видатних конструктивних особливостей Fling – це впускний отвір, система катапультування, яка має кривошипну конструкцію, і складене передавальне число, яке використовується для переміщення рукоятки катапульти.

Прийом м'яча

fling-intro-06.png

Fling's Intake складається з двох 40-міліметрових (мм) шківів, розділених опорами, і чотирьох гумових стрічок, натягнутих між шківами.

Гумки ефективно захоплюють кулі, коли Intake обертається.

Приймач може обертатися, щоб втягнути кулю, або перевернутися, щоб випустити кулю.

fling-intro-07.png

Потужність від двигуна впуску передається за допомогою двох 10-міліметрових (мм) шківів і гумового ременя.

Це забезпечує плавну передачу потужності. Якщо м’яч заклинить у впускному отворі, гумовий ремінь просто зісковзне, запобігаючи будь-якому пошкодженню.

Катапультна система стрільби Crank-Design

fling-intro-08.png

Ударно-спусковий механізм для Fling's Catapult Arm — це дуже плавний зворотно-поступальний пристрій.

Він складається з набору шестерень із 60 зубами та шарнірного важеля натягу.

Натяжний важіль обертається на штифті, прикріпленому до зовнішнього краю шестерень. Це створює налаштування кривошипа під час обертання передач.

На протилежній від шарнірного з’єднання стороні шестерні знаходиться втулка вала. Втулка захопить натяжний важіль і збільшить довжину кривошипа.

Коли рукоятка змушує шарнірний важіль натягу стати коротшим, він тягне важіль катапульти вниз і збільшує натяг гумових стрічок важелі катапульти.

Після того, як кривошипно-шатунна тяга переміщується за центральну точку, втулка валу втрачає контакт із кривошипно-шатунною тягою та звільняє натяжний важіль, запускаючи катапульту.

Весь цей цикл повторюється, оскільки шестерні продовжують обертатися. Бамперний перемикач налаштований на зупинку обертання передач безпосередньо перед тим, як рука катапульти досягне своєї центральної точки.

Це дозволяє завантажувати м’яч на руку катапульти з входу.

Складене передавальне число, що використовується для переміщення катапультної руки

fling-intro-04-new.png

Кожен, хто коли-небудь намагався взяти мітлу, тримаючись за самий кінець її рукоятки, відчував обертальний момент.

Система редуктора для руки катапульти повинна мати достатній крутний момент, щоб подолати натяг гумових стрічок руки. Крім того, рука катапульти використовується для підвішування до підвісної штанги, тому вона також повинна мати достатній крутний момент, щоб підняти вагу робота.

Цей крутний момент створюється за допомогою двоступеневої складеної передавальної частини.

fling-intro-11.png

Перша частина складеного передавального числа має 12-зубчасту ведучу передачу, яка приводиться в дію від двигуна.

Ведуча шестерня з 12 зубами приводить у рух ведену шестерню з 36 зубами.

Ця шестерня з 12 зубів на шестерню з 36 зубами забезпечує передавальне число 3:1.

Шестерня з 36 зубами обертається зі швидкістю 1/3 швидкості двигуна. Однак він передає своєму валу в 3 рази більший крутний момент.

fling-intro-12.png

Друга частина складеного передавального числа має пару ведучих шестерень з 12 зубами. Ці 12-зубчасті шестерні мають той самий вал, що й 36-зубчаста шестерня з першої частини складеного передавального числа.

Між парою шестерень із 12 зубцями та парою шестерень із 60 зубцями на механізмі спрацьовування катапульти розташована пара 36-зубових проміжних шестерень. Протяжні шестерні не змінюють передавальне число.

Ці 12-зубчасті шестерні на 60-зубчасті шестерні забезпечують передавальне число 5:1.

Поєднання двох передавальних чисел 3:1 і 5:1 утворює складене передавальне число 15:1

При майже 15-кратному обертальному моменті двигуна Catapult це забезпечує Fling великим обертовим моментом, щоб як запускати руку катапульти, так і піднімати її вагу з поля за допомогою підвісної штанги.


Поради та підказки щодо програмування Fling за допомогою VEXcode IQ

Налаштування трансмісії Fling

Screen_Shot_2021-06-16_at_12.24.30_PM.png

Виконайте кроки у цій статті з бібліотеки VEXщоб отримати загальну інформацію про те, як налаштувати трансмісію з 2 двигунами.

Щоб налаштувати 2-моторну трансмісію Fling, виберіть порт 1 для лівого двигуна та порт 3 для правого двигуна.

fling-intro-13.png

Щоб переконатися, що налаштування налаштовано відповідно до фізичних розмірів Fling:

  • змінити ширину колії з 173 мм до 267 мм.

Для отримання додаткової інформації про ширину колії перегляньте цю статтю з бібліотеки VEX.

Налаштування катапульти та впускних двигунів

Screen_Shot_2021-06-16_at_12.32.18_PM.png

Виконайте кроки, наведені в цій статті з бібліотеки VEX, щоб отримати загальну інформацію про те, як налаштувати двигун.

  • Щоб налаштувати спеціальний впускний двигун Fling, виберіть порт 2.
  • Щоб налаштувати спеціальний двигун катапульти Fling, виберіть порт 4.

Налаштування перемикача бампера

Screen_Shot_2021-06-16_at_12.48.58_PM.png

Виконайте кроки, наведені в цій статті з бібліотеки VEXщоб отримати загальну інформацію про те, як налаштувати бамперний перемикач.

Щоб налаштувати спеціальний перемикач бампера Fling, виберіть порт 5.

Налаштування контролера

Screen_Shot_2021-06-16_at_1.00.36_PM.png

IQ Controller може бути налаштований для управління Fling, а також керування Intake.

Виконайте кроки, наведені в цій статті з бібліотеки VEX, щоб отримати загальну інформацію про те, як налаштувати контролер.

Примітка: конфігурація Fling НЕ дозволяє програмі драйвера VEX IQ Brain за замовчуванням працювати з контролером.

Screen_Shot_2021-06-16_at_12.58.40_PM.png

Будь-яку групу кнопок на контролері можна використовувати для керування Fling's Intake.

Примітка: Fling's Intake необхідно налаштувати перед налаштуванням контролера.

Використання двигуна катапульти з контролером

Screen_Shot_2021-06-16_at_1.14.02_PM.png

Встановіть зупинку CatapultArmMotor на утримання. Це утримає катапульту Флінга на місці після підвішування.

Screen_Shot_2021-06-16_at_1.15.31_PM.png

Виберіть кнопку контролера, щоб налаштувати стрілянину з катапульти Fling.

Screen_Shot_2021-06-16_at_1.16.26_PM.png

Виберіть кнопку контролера, щоб запустити катапульту.

Ця кнопка також перемістить руку вниз, щоб Fling міг повиснути на підвісній панелі.

Щоб дізнатися більше про кодування Fling за допомогою VEXcode IQ, перегляньте ці статті з бібліотеки VEX.


Додавання датчиків IQ

VIQC-Fling-Left-Side.png

Fling розроблено для легкого додавання будь-яких датчиків IQ. Правила ігрового робота Pitching In дозволяють багато налаштувати вашого бота Fling Hero.

Для отримання додаткової інформації про датчики IQ перегляньте цей розділ бібліотеки VEX.

Ви також можете переглянути цю статтю про Virtual Fling який використовується у VIQC Virtual Skills , щоб побачити приклади того, як датчики можна додавати до Fling.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: